de.hunsicker.jalopy.plugin.jdeveloper.message
Class MessagePage.FileTreeNode

java.lang.Object
  |
  +--javax.swing.tree.DefaultMutableTreeNode
        |
        +--de.hunsicker.jalopy.plugin.jdeveloper.message.MessageTreeNode
              |
              +--de.hunsicker.jalopy.plugin.jdeveloper.message.MessagePage.FileTreeNode
All Implemented Interfaces:
java.lang.Cloneable, javax.swing.tree.MutableTreeNode, java.io.Serializable, javax.swing.tree.TreeNode
Enclosing class:
MessagePage

protected static class MessagePage.FileTreeNode
extends MessageTreeNode

A FileTreeNode acts as the parent node for all message nodes of a given file.

See Also:
Serialized Form

Nested Class Summary
 
Nested classes inherited from class de.hunsicker.jalopy.plugin.jdeveloper.message.MessageTreeNode
MessageTreeNode.Type
 
Field Summary
 
Fields inherited from class javax.swing.tree.DefaultMutableTreeNode
allowsChildren, children, EMPTY_ENUMERATION, parent, userObject
 
Constructor Summary
MessagePage.FileTreeNode(Message message, javax.swing.tree.DefaultTreeModel model)
           
 
Method Summary
 void addMessage(Message message, boolean refresh)
           
 void setParent(javax.swing.tree.MutableTreeNode node)
           
 
Methods inherited from class javax.swing.tree.DefaultMutableTreeNode
add, breadthFirstEnumeration, children, clone, depthFirstEnumeration, getAllowsChildren, getChildAfter, getChildAt, getChildBefore, getChildCount, getDepth, getFirstChild, getFirstLeaf, getIndex, getLastChild, getLastLeaf, getLeafCount, getLevel, getNextLeaf, getNextNode, getNextSibling, getParent, getPath, getPathToRoot, getPreviousLeaf, getPreviousNode, getPreviousSibling, getRoot, getSharedAncestor, getSiblingCount, getUserObject, getUserObjectPath, insert, isLeaf, isNodeAncestor, isNodeChild, isNodeDescendant, isNodeRelated, isNodeSibling, isRoot, pathFromAncestorEnumeration, postorderEnumeration, preorderEnumeration, remove, remove, removeAllChildren, removeFromParent, setAllowsChildren, setUserObject, toString
 
Methods inherited from class java.lang.Object
equals, finalize, getClass, hashCode, notify, notifyAll, wait, wait, wait
 

Constructor Detail

MessagePage.FileTreeNode

public MessagePage.FileTreeNode(Message message,
                                javax.swing.tree.DefaultTreeModel model)
Method Detail

setParent

public void setParent(javax.swing.tree.MutableTreeNode node)
Specified by:
setParent in interface javax.swing.tree.MutableTreeNode
Overrides:
setParent in class javax.swing.tree.DefaultMutableTreeNode

addMessage

public void addMessage(Message message,
                       boolean refresh)


Copyright © 1997-2005 Jalopy. All Rights Reserved.